On 04/19/2012 04:35 PM, Steve wrote:
> I've been using Visual Slickedit for over 10 years. I'm now working my
> way through the help files in Eclipse. I decided to give it a try since
> it is *almost* a defacto standard in Java shops.
>
> I've been impressed with what I have seen so far.
>
> I understand that the other contender for popular, free, plugin based
> JAVA IDE is NetBeans.
>
> I understand there may just be religious issues as far as which one a
> person should choose, but while I understand the differences in
> philosophies between an older religious war: emacs and vi, I don't with
> Eclipse and NetBeans.
>
> Both are written in Java, both are IDEs, both are built to take in new
> functionality via plugins.
>
> So, what are the big differences between the two that make some people
> go with one and others with the other?
>
> Thanks in advance for any polite, non-critical, non-negative opinions
>
> Steve

 From limited experiance with both, I found Netbeans easier to get 
productive with. It is simpler, and for me intuitive to use. I found 
Eclipse less intuitive, and in some cases the help wasn't much help. I 
suspect that Netbeans is fine for relatively small projects, with only a 
few team memebers. Eclipse seems to be aimed at larger projects, with a 
large team.
